arpwatch-2.1a15-lp152.6.9.1<>,A`*T/=„KM%F2hR )'_k&ڃWtȚV%= ?Uv+tmbF%P?%@d   N  &Ilrz  X x    @D`(8 9 : =>%?-@5F=GXHIXY\]X^ bc d!e! f!#l!%u!8v!xw$Hx$y$z$$$$%<Carpwatch2.1a15lp152.6.9.1Keeps Track of Ethernet and IP Address PairingsArpwatch keeps track of Ethernet and IP address pairings. It logs activity to syslog and reports certain changes via e-mail.`*Tobs-power9-06IyopenSUSE Leap 15.2openSUSEBSD-3-Clausehttp://bugs.opensuse.orgProductivity/Networking/Diagnostichttp://www-nrg.ee.lbl.gov/nrg.htmllinuxppc64le if [ -x /usr/bin/systemctl ]; then test -n "$FIRST_ARG" || FIRST_ARG="$1" [ -d /var/lib/systemd/migrated ] || mkdir -p /var/lib/systemd/migrated || : for service in arpwatch.service ; do sysv_service=${service%.*} if [ ! -e /usr/lib/systemd/system/$service ] && [ ! -e /etc/init.d/$sysv_service ]; then mkdir -p /run/systemd/rpm/needs-preset touch /run/systemd/rpm/needs-preset/$service elif [ -e /etc/init.d/$sysv_service ] && [ ! -e /var/lib/systemd/migrated/$sysv_service ]; then /usr/sbin/systemd-sysv-convert --save $sysv_service || : mkdir -p /run/systemd/rpm/needs-sysv-convert touch /run/systemd/rpm/needs-sysv-convert/$service fi done fi if [ -x /usr/bin/systemctl ]; then test -n "$FIRST_ARG" || FIRST_ARG="$1" [ -d /var/lib/systemd/migrated ] || mkdir -p /var/lib/systemd/migrated || : if [ "$YAST_IS_RUNNING" != "instsys" ]; then /usr/bin/systemctl daemon-reload || : fi for service in arpwatch.service ; do sysv_service=${service%.*} if [ -e /run/systemd/rpm/needs-preset/$service ]; then /usr/bin/systemctl preset $service || : rm "/run/systemd/rpm/needs-preset/$service" || : elif [ -e /run/systemd/rpm/needs-sysv-convert/$service ]; then /usr/sbin/systemd-sysv-convert --apply $sysv_service || : rm "/run/systemd/rpm/needs-sysv-convert/$service" || : touch /var/lib/systemd/migrated/$sysv_service || : fi done fi PNAME=arpwatch SUBPNAME= SYSC_TEMPLATE=/usr/share/fillup-templates/sysconfig.$PNAME$SUBPNAME # If template not in new /usr/share/fillup-templates, fallback to old TEMPLATE_DIR if [ ! -f $SYSC_TEMPLATE ] ; then TEMPLATE_DIR=/var/adm/fillup-templates SYSC_TEMPLATE=$TEMPLATE_DIR/sysconfig.$PNAME$SUBPNAME fi SD_NAME="" if [ -x /bin/fillup ] ; then if [ -f $SYSC_TEMPLATE ] ; then echo "Updating /etc/sysconfig/$SD_NAME$PNAME ..." mkdir -p /etc/sysconfig/$SD_NAME touch /etc/sysconfig/$SD_NAME$PNAME /bin/fillup -q /etc/sysconfig/$SD_NAME$PNAME $SYSC_TEMPLATE fi else echo "ERROR: fillup not found. This should not happen. Please compare" echo "/etc/sysconfig/$PNAME and $TEMPLATE_DIR/sysconfig.$PNAME and" echo "update by hand." fi [ -z "${TRANSACTIONAL_UPDATE}" -a -x /usr/bin/systemd-tmpfiles ] && /usr/bin/systemd-tmpfiles --create /usr/lib/tmpfiles.d/arpwatch.conf || : test -n "$FIRST_ARG" || FIRST_ARG="$1" if [ "$FIRST_ARG" -eq 0 -a -x /usr/bin/systemctl ]; then # Package removal, not upgrade /usr/bin/systemctl --no-reload disable arpwatch.service || : ( test "$YAST_IS_RUNNING" = instsys && exit 0 test -f /etc/sysconfig/services -a \ -z "$DISABLE_STOP_ON_REMOVAL" && . /etc/sysconfig/services test "$DISABLE_STOP_ON_REMOVAL" = yes -o \ "$DISABLE_STOP_ON_REMOVAL" = 1 && exit 0 /usr/bin/systemctl stop arpwatch.service ) || : fi test -n "$FIRST_ARG" || FIRST_ARG="$1" if [ $1 -eq 0 ]; then # Package removal for service in arpwatch.service ; do sysv_service="${service%.*}" rm "/var/lib/systemd/migrated/$sysv_service" || : done fi if [ -x /usr/bin/systemctl ]; then /usr/bin/systemctl daemon-reload || : fi if [ "$FIRST_ARG" -ge 1 ]; then # Package upgrade, not uninstall if [ -x /usr/bin/systemctl ]; then ( test "$YAST_IS_RUNNING" = instsys && exit 0 test -f /etc/sysconfig/services -a \ -z "$DISABLE_RESTART_ON_UPDATE" && . /etc/sysconfig/services test "$DISABLE_RESTART_ON_UPDATE" = yes -o \ "$DISABLE_RESTART_ON_UPDATE" = 1 && exit 0 /usr/bin/systemctl try-restart arpwatch.service ) || : fi fic` p @yf` 큤mmA큤$$A`*S`*S`*S`*S`*S`*S`*S`*TDnDT><7[c`*S`*S`*S`*S`*T72fc48f8381d4ada5da01f936fe3c5dfc5340c9dffeb6e77973c35f85988ecfc91898bb997dd1f6bf7dc6d9dc4f4e2bdea5f09a14e398ef9996cf5b4f6f17828628995f9800879b56ace2905eba554d9d91a0ee5da5295dcc46731759b7d2c144a85c40d7a432656c79c09c863e951ba7d7d721af807914e1c2d423cffe43924fb499e9753c852bad728c4dc477c468526e9614646ee19d63b0aea184784610324fa6e473af7735d98262691ef0f77d5ad3b066758ccae60c78a76071becc6c24e4f3a8f6fd6f1b98c99b48825391bdbfa4b6ae543ecdaa5bb7d7c74564ddd76c6144468ade4e7b6fbe09962d0c2a7ee349c73ff9e0c34975102cf15764dd99145a9ab61a2ac66d37c89e07a5722c3b4133e31e6d400246c219d6ec7c78505084e9e00ecc8115792da1d4b0be4ec2ec9db6540c990524f28bf0d7e6f873c68315dc977de1acf261cd7dea03e70d21cc1da53bbcce5452283eac3d5e12e40931d793ec40b20829623d44cd1cbf0c5258599a70c4f335e373e29e89de34fb2b4ddservice@@root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ootrootarpwatch-2.1a15-lp152.6.9.1.src.rpmarpwatcharpwatch(ppc-64) @@@@    /bin/sh/bin/sh/bin/sh/bin/sh/bin/sharpwatch-ethercodescoreutilsdiffutilsfillupgreplibc.so.6()(64bit)libc.so.6(GLIBC_2.17)(64bit)libpcap.so.1()(64bit)rpmlib(CompressedFileNames)rpmlib(FileDigests)rpmlib(PayloadFilesHavePrefix)rpmlib(PayloadIsXz)3.0.4-14.6.0-14.0-15.2-14.14.1`D`"y@`@\YzZ@YU@T@SsZR@Johannes Segitz Johannes Segitz Johannes Segitz jsegitz@suse.comrbrown@suse.comtchvatal@suse.comlmuelle@suse.comlmuelle@suse.commeissner@suse.comrmilasan@suse.com- Fixed local privilege escalation from runtime user to root (bsc#1186240, CVE-2021-25321)- Fix arp2ethers script (bsc#1181936). Added arp2ethers.patch to inline the awk fragments.- Include arp2ethers script (jsc#SLE-17224)- added getnameinfo.patch to prevent memory leak in gethname (bsc#1119851)- Replace references to /var/adm/fillup-templates with new %_fillupdir macro (boo#1069468)- Remove initscript support. Fix the service initialization to\ either allow single full client or user has to symlink the instance and make sure he can run only one of them. bsc#737527 - Make sure rcarpwatch is working - Use install commands for installation of files - Format with spec-cleaner - Generate temp files using systemd- Deal with added two whitespaces in more recent oui.txt versions. + arpwatch-2.1a15-massagevendor.patch- Removed executable permission bits from arpwatch@.service file.- added missing %pre/%service_add_pre section- Rework arpwatch.service file to properly support multiple network interfaces and arpwatch sysconfig file. (bnc#853384)./bin/sh/bin/sh/bin/sh/bin/shobs-power9-06 1624975956 2.1a15-lp152.6.9.12.1a15-lp152.6.9.1 arp2ethersarpwatch.servicearpwatch@.servicearpwatch.confarpsnmparpwatchrcarpwatcharpwatchCHANGESFILESREADMEsysconfig.arpwatcharpsnmp.8.gzarpwatch.8.gzarpwatcharp.dat/usr/bin//usr/lib/systemd/system//usr/lib/tmpfiles.d//usr/sbin//usr/share/doc/packages//usr/share/doc/packages/arpwatch//usr/share/fillup-templates//usr/share/man/man8//var/lib//var/lib/arpwatch/-fmessage-length=0 -grecord-gcc-switches -O2 -Wall -D_FORTIFY_SOURCE=2 -fstack-protector-strong -funwind-tables -fasynchronous-unwind-tables -fstack-clash-protection -gobs://build.opensuse.org/openSUSE:Maintenance:16630/openSUSE_Leap_15.2_Update_ports/1358a0ac64217e969600728b8ab207cc-arpwatch.openSUSE_Leap_15.2_Updatedrpmxz5ppc64le-suse-linuxPOSIX shell script, ASCII text executableASCII textELF 64-bit LSB shared object, 64-bit PowerPC or cisco 7500, version 1 (SYSV), dynamically linked, interpreter /lib64/ld64.so.2, BuildID[sha1]=1e2d0daba41ec4a9beea3c5a104feac137bfce3e, for GNU/Linux 3.10.0, strippedELF 64-bit LSB shared object, 64-bit PowerPC or cisco 7500, version 1 (SYSV), dynamically linked, interpreter /lib64/ld64.so.2, BuildID[sha1]=ee847187bdf5f12d55f34993d87556739ee2b183, for GNU/Linux 3.10.0, strippeddirectorytroff or preprocessor input, ASCII text (gzip compressed data, max compression, from Unix)cannot open `/home/abuild/rpmbuild/BUILDROOT/arpwatch-2.1a15-lp152.6.9.1.ppc64le/var/lib/arpwatch/arp.dat' (No such file or directory)RR R R R R X-:|Qutf-85566c838e9903a5d03bf514ed988dbbcedfb8c316db8b0e42542b7c5180edc4b?7zXZ !t/.&]"k%{=JKmDWm"`-EV:E,c&NyI?ުInJe 绹la=j[y7YRP(aQ#*%%G 2 "x:f;4:ƚ@Gۻxz7qlhbגsF'#Й9| pj:x5>du阁r&˗خgx\/:NwDf 15[AKf+ݾY3CYEhmUJ̞s4봔<ZQz"\FG;;A'm`rei3 vw4m]! - u r<ȷ%9s|A6[ 'TMaˍC~d a *{@Y'ϽlW5iG#}Cy;5奡hYP]m/LKgdwy0YKE', \;i5P4ܶFmk~8{A=|%7dۖ 5p?P9oqFdD^=7ꆘ @BXΞv.5,+Q/@;iّc|TKsfńӍB\ΡRV/mZRm[3<L /Qr2s 0ȨƤe),cwgqm.]!-QVhr-Y4h{kYmȨ lz ̊1|+ ɕ3%ej0WcZ2 َ?$iD6RA7ᡒ3ZrO~! S6\U"vjf_+6 74f1<8^O[ʮU9[%bL9')g 0kY6|dzfNn~"I!9x_F%g8 rq>oSjY!mT^AdqNCA^?OIw`E1AO\l6YcȸA L/["o|W_["^1SS0(t-( e88cT>UD ZSn9sQU, ѦJ'idYIDLQG*ʯxkiCXFtoq 8p hWvJE@CNNj"I۶"c" ӣ ڈ qDjDԱ)N am? K6Q ` ^k"-$[ (#YZri~! d SE|ʝ dEj/ M9ûm+Jf@`-SR6zP`N~0eK;omVY#W RRE>4W-5BCޞx"N!tb(I'*zhW4Ԫ"i>xb6Dݘ_uO7[v-~ ,Q bҤÚu:*ȑHE'V)ҺP@9up{fH*φ4Gy 荱&WXWSyeh8~*A`t1`i`, \\4N_L[m3-;iM9{n1!W6!x2UV="ߔ$z_O6xDm8h B= B {&2́f}iw=Tx̳=K@J$ TSEc5. "m_ 5O$c TU[UZi1jޤ#JA[rR_| EB!x[yz{‘=2/k\;o{n 77*$W_Y$37qJΩzX*{A?O풊>3ގ v}y4K~/bgL J28 +ϨiYƖ.zqN7+|ۄK,aw:/q[4FafY\9ҝ. X(RQhq s<0_Dpo% GLZFm)xy( J6UfS~`tˢ.MdwX:~ƈV*<,}*6C)oWk*$ P7=j"!^=!}8b+ju,-quC&B\F੪`YncYa 7Be&J#casoJ@T<-SH`ޣ_t8GE`p}'m%S,ZdƪЫRm/27_wⲦFk0NLQz4 f#nlI 2P(do"LVD(dupȡ#)CJ&SO%_2 8˳JƖE~m*dKٜ+AyX;/N=ȀA"HlHY<B=M GT|^⠖D_o@\8Mu3Xo~OXe-hf֋z"W8AcuV<y:  .ȥkɏ{(kz1e9錡$TtGmS, ÃPBBu,~dvN'ᆄ-wyʵ&`q$|@5DINW7|rb'!_;VtO .tls`+:oe&Aӝ;,ggUrw<(7"hX2ҏ0}~r#$ L1ezwQ cU#vPpm)H'mWQ7VY4Ҫ1U0v6,,oFӈxZVUF 6f$&KS&|U!vg W(,T8g(WsCƇ=PbDeka! 4s)b+Qk/$dž1?U/bCQS"H3,2$PѸ%3hc% @-p]JZ) םh33lÌŇ* ѐTzEV%7Gt@\x}tn$%^{Bmd}\u {g,&Ҩ(T5K#;$,#h*͹1Ir60$.\> YZ